Operators hit with Public Inquiries over trailer defects
 

Senior Traffic Commissioner Richard Turfitt (pictured) has warned hauliers of their obligations regarding trailers amid a spate of Public Inquiries following serious transgressions. Speaking at the Microlise Transport Conference last week, Turfitt said: "I need to flag up a concerning pattern of cases emerging from last year. It involves the maintenance of third-party trailers. "There have been considerable efforts by the DVSA to make test reports available to all, but operators seem oblivious to maintaining trailers.
